You administer a Microsoft SQL Server database.
You create an availability group named haContosoDbs. Your primary replica is available at Server01\Contoso01.
You need to configure the availability group to prevent data loss. In the event of a database failure, the designed secondary database must come online automatically.
Which Transact-SQL statement should you use?

A. ALTER AVAILABILITY GROUP haContosoDbs MODITY REPLICA ON Server01\Contoso01 WITH (AVAILABILITY _MODE=ASYNCHRONOUS_COMMIT, FAILOVER_MODE=AUTOMATIC)
B. ALTER AVAILABILITY GROUP haContosoDbs MODIFY REPLICA ON Server01\Contoso01 WITH (AVAILABILITY _MODE=ASYNCHRONOUS_COMMIT, FAILOVER_MODE=MANUAL)
C. ALTER AVAILABILITY GROUP haContosoDbs MODITY REPLICA ON Server01\Contoso01 WITH (AVAILABILITY _MODE=SYNCHRONOUS_COMMIT, FAILOVER_MODE=AUTOMATIC)
D. ALTER AVAILABILITY GROUP haContosoDbs MODIFY REPLICA ON Server01\Contoso01 WITH (AVAILABILITY _MODE=SYNCHRONOUS_COMMIT, FAILOVER_MODE=MANUAL)
